Quade was at his best when Link was coaching him and he could be in the pocket and let the forwards and the 9 grind (often around the corner as quickly as they could) until they got fast ball and a mismatch. He would then call for the ball and leverage the mismatch

To play that style takes a significant commitment from the team to play to those strengths

And there are very few sides today that build a game centering around the ball playing of the 10 to create the majority of the opportunities.

Today, due to NZ's influence, the game is more about ensemble play, playing flatter and quality catch and pass skills of the team to leverage those mismatches

Indeed- the biggest change I have seen in rugby in the last 3 years in the upskilling of forwards.
